What is a claims made malpractice policy? ›

Claims-Made Policies

Claims-made insurance provides coverage only for incidents that occurred and were reported while you are insured with that carrier. Thus, both the incident and the filing of the claim must happen while the policy is in effect.

What is the difference between occurrence and claims made? ›

Essentially, for a claim to be considered for coverage, an occurrence-based policy needs to be active when the act or incident occurs; claims made policies have to be active when the claim is made.

What are the four elements of a negligence claim in a medical malpractice lawsuit? ›

To do so, four legal elements must be proven: (1) a professional duty owed to the patient; (2) breach of such duty; (3) injury caused by the breach; and (4) resulting damages.

What is medical malpractice vs negligence? ›

When a medical provider's actions or inactions fail to meet the medical standard of care, their behavior constitutes medical negligence. If their medical negligence causes their patient to suffer an injury, it becomes medical malpractice.

What does subrogation mean? ›

When you file a claim, your insurer can try to recover costs from the person responsible for your injury or property damage. This is known as subrogation. For example: Your insurance company pays your doctor for your treatment following an auto accident that someone else caused.

What is tail coverage malpractice? ›

An extended reporting endorsem*nt – often called an ERE or tail coverage– is an endorsem*nt to your policy that provides a period of time to make or report a claim after a policy expires or is cancelled.

Will a claims made policy always pay a covered claim that occurs? ›

A claims-made policy only covers those that occur and are reported within the policy's timeframe, unless tail coverage is also purchased. An occurrence policy provides lifetime coverage for incidents that take place during a policy period, regardless of when the claim is reported.

What is the difference between medical error and medical malpractice? ›

The distinction lies in whether the medical professional who made the error failed to treat a patient in accordance with the recognized standard of care. If so, the medical error amounts to malpractice. The medical professional could be liable for any resulting harm.
